Adrian Wojnarowski
@wojespn


New Orleans was able to offer only $2.2M to Monroe for balance of season. Cousins was injured past cutoff date to get Disabled Player Exception. Celtics had $8.4M to use via Gordon Hayward injury.

Bobby Marks
@BobbyMarks42


The Greg Monroe $5M contract for 10 weeks of work with the Celtics( plus the playoffs) is equal to a player signing a $13M contract before the season started.

So I'm thinking the Suns waived him to save significant money. Also, I'm guessing this would be why they didn't wait until the trade deadline.
